she feels words like pictures that move
reads books solitaire with the afternoon
coffee on her tongue
she turns the page
sets her cup down
and marks her place
in her mind she tries to find
a single place where thoughts subside
and try she may
to drown her lies
only thing wet
her lonely eyes
© Melissa Carlson 2015
